Inades-Formation Burkina was present at the AfriFOODlinks consortium meeting held from June 19 to 23, 2023 in Kisumu, Kenya. The meeting was organized to further connect the consortium partners, to jointly review the work underway in the different cities and the results already achieved.
The AfriFOODlinks project aims to ” Transform Africa’s urban food environments by strengthening links between food system stakeholders in African and European cities “. More than 65 towns and 26 organizations are involved. This project is funded by the European Union for a period of 4 years (December 2022 to November 2026).
The AfriFOODlinks consortium meeting in Kisumu provided a forum for mutual learning between the project’s participating towns, and laid the foundations for project monitoring and evaluation. Over the course of five days, the hundred or so participants enjoyed a wealth of experiences through various events, moments of creativity, sharing and discovery. The meeting was punctuated by panels, plenary sessions, closed-door meetings, visits to markets and supermarkets, as well as peri-urban farming and composting processing sites.
In the Burkina Faso delegation at the AfriFOODlinks consortium meeting in Kisumu, the Director of Inades-Formation Burkina was alongside representatives from the city of Ouagadougou, AFP/APME, ADEU, the Institut de Recherche en Sciences Appliquées Technologie (IRSAT) and Rikolto. At the end of the meeting, the various participants left with a better understanding of the project’s activities and concepts, and a better mutual knowledge of the partners.
